Ramnagar is a Village located in the Taluka of Baruipur, in the district of South Twenty Four Parganas district, in the state of West Bengal state with a total population of 17053. There are 3964 houses in the Village.

Ramnagar Population by Sex

There are total of 8706 male persons and 8347 females and a total number of 1867 children below 6 years in Ramnagar.
The percentage of male population is 51.05%.
The percentage of female population is 48.95%.
The percentage of child population is 10.95%.
